Ingredients
To create this delicious Cucumber Tomato Avocado Salad, you’ll need the following ingredients:
- 2 medium cucumbers, diced
- 2 large tomatoes, chopped
- 2 ripe avocados, diced
- ¼ small red onion, thinly sliced
- 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
- 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
- ¼ cup fresh cilantro, chopped
- Salt and black pepper to taste

How to Make the Recipe
Making this salad is as easy as 1-2-3! Here’s how:
- Wash and dice the cucumbers. Chop the tomatoes and dice the avocados. Thinly slice the red onion.
- In a large salad bowl, combine the cucumbers, tomatoes, avocados, and red onion.
- In a small bowl, whisk together the lemon juice, olive oil, salt, and black pepper.
- Pour the dressing over the salad and gently toss to combine, being careful not to mash the avocado.
- Sprinkle the chopped cilantro over the salad and serve immediately.
Pro Tips for Making the Recipe
Here are some of my favorite tips to ensure your Avocado Tomato Salad turns out perfectly every time:
- Choose ripe avocados for the best flavor and creaminess.
- Feel free to add other ingredients like bell peppers or corn for extra crunch.
- For a bit of heat, add diced jalapeños or a sprinkle of red pepper flakes.
- Make sure to serve the salad fresh to enjoy the vibrant flavors.

Make Ahead and Storage
If you want to prepare this salad in advance, here are some tips:
- Chop the vegetables and store them separately in airtight containers to keep them fresh.
- Mix the dressing in advance and store it in the fridge until you’re ready to serve.
- Assembled salad is best enjoyed fresh, but if you have leftovers, store them in the fridge for up to a day. Just be aware that the avocado may brown slightly.
